Transaction 2d889a72cf6338b6b2cf0f512958d9bcd20638a3b0204306dd00eaec2e8f0806

2 Input
2 Outputs
  • 2d889a72cf6338b6b2cf0f512958d9bcd20638a3b0204306dd00eaec2e8f0806:0
  • value  11320632
    address  3A3bEyrKm8de44Yds1YcKBWN7P9WVrcqMR
  • 2d889a72cf6338b6b2cf0f512958d9bcd20638a3b0204306dd00eaec2e8f0806:1
  • value  558520
    address  3BfzdbyVvgKY7kWTRuHosHNgTFap3qZucy